[0913] Session Report

 

Bugs:

  • When returning to Main Menu the first time from a running game to start a new game heads of (self created) sovereigns are missing/not visible
  • Could not end a round/press turn: My city was attacked, after I won the battle there was another message that my city is attacked, but nothing happened. The same or another army of the same kind was standing near to my city. I could not continue playing.
  • Arrow range attack of a champion reaches aim from the wrong side/shooting from the left
  • I casted the spell "tremor" on an assassin demon standing near to my city to immobilize it (2 seasons it says...), the next season I killed the demon, but got the message that one of my improvements was destroyed by the demon
  • I killed an army of wildlings, but it died on another field after the battle, so as if it has moved

Comments:

 

  • Difficulty Levels: Perhaps it would be nice to make "challenging" a little bit more challenging and "hard" a little bit less hard. I know I asked for competition, but "hard" was now a felt "ridiculous", the AI settled everywhere in shortest time and ran around with big armies or one sovereign killing a lot of monsters so I could neither settle nor battle. Perhaps it was a special situation on that map, but spaces for settlement are always rare and I played on standard settings on a medium map. I had "green" areas in two directions (with AI-Cities) and deserts in the other two directions. Or there is missing a difficult-level between these levels, because on "challenging" I attacked the second city of an opponent I met first with three units and some time after this he became my vassal. After this I had double the strength of the next player I met.

 

  • Wolf Pelts/Spider silk: I get a lot of stuff like spider silks or wolf pelts.I think the sense of this stuff should be to sell it, but I never care for this, the profit is uninteresting. My suggestion would be to make it possible to form special equipment for regular troops out of that stuff (limited to the amount of things you have) similar to a quest I did where someone makes you a coat out of pelts. Or to open special building options, like a fur-trader, or to gain special abilities. This would it make more interesting to collect these things and would give these things a stronger meaning. Or just little more money...For the gameplay this stuff is not really relevant, but I do not walk back to a town to sell pelts for 4 guilders.
